  The Current Project:
 A big, hot, heavy pair of monoblock power amps; using type 211/VT-4C power triodes, driven by transformer-coupled type 45's. I'll be using a pair of the recently released Hammond 126B interstage transformers, and Hammond 1638SEA output transformers.
